Located in the heart of the ancient seaside port of Watchet, Croft Cottages offer a wide range of properties to suit any size and requirement. All the cottages (refs W44203, W44204, W44206, W44207, W44208, W44209, W44210, W44211 and W44212) are well furnished and presented and their convenient location within Watchet adds to their appeal.
Located just off the high street means guests can wander into town for a walk around the harbour, eat and drink in the local restaurants and pubs, and also catch a train at the local station of the renowned West Somerset Steam Railway. There is a regular bus service so you won’t even need the car. There are beaches at Blue Anchor, Kilve and Dunster. The regional town of Minehead is a short distance away and with a very good range of shops and other local amenities. Take a walk along the promenade overlooking the picturesque harbour and enjoy an ice cream. Minehead is also the start of the South West Coastal Path which provides some challenging yet spectacular walking. The pretty medieval village of Dunster, with its castle (National Trust) is well worth a day out. Other areas of interest close by are Porlock and Porlock Weir and a little further along the coast are Lynton and Lynmouth, the two towns connected by the Victorian cliff railway. Exmoor National Park offers great walking for all abilities and there are some great spots to visit including Withypool, Lanacre and Tarr Steps. Shop, pub and restaurant 200 yards.
